当前位置: 首页 > 软件教程 > 文章内容页

利用Cookie实现微信小店长期免登录操作指南

时间:2025-06-30    作者:游乐小编    

想要微信小店长期免登录,核心方法是利用cookie。1. 首先通过浏览器开发者工具或抓包工具登录时抓取关键cookie,如wx_session、wx_token;2. 接着以json格式存储cookie便于后续读取;3. 在请求头中携带cookie访问接口实现免登录;4. 定期更新cookie以应对有效期限制;5. 为避免被识别为非法操作,应控制请求频率、使用真实user-agent并模拟用户行为;6. 同时需防范cookie泄露风险,应加密存储、限制使用范围、定期检查安全性并设置ip白名单。只要妥善处理这些环节,即可实现安全稳定的微信小店长期免登录。

利用Cookie实现微信小店长期免登录操作指南

想要微信小店长期免登录?简单来说,利用Cookie就行!但这其中有些门道,别着急,咱们一步步来。

解决方案

首先,我们要搞清楚微信小店的登录机制。它不像传统的网页登录,直接用账号密码就能搞定。它依赖于微信授权,授权后会生成一些凭证,比如Cookie。我们要做的,就是抓住这些Cookie,让它们“记住”你的登录状态。

抓取Cookie: 这是第一步,也是最关键的一步。你需要一个工具,比如浏览器的开发者工具(F12),或者专门的HTTP抓包工具(如Charles、Fiddler)。登录你的微信小店,然后在开发者工具的网络(Network)面板里,找到登录相关的请求。仔细分析这些请求的Header,你会发现一些关键的Cookie,比如wx_session、wx_token之类的。记住,不同的微信小店,Cookie的名称可能不一样,要具体问题具体分析。

存储Cookie: 抓到Cookie之后,就要把它们保存起来。你可以选择用文本文件、数据库,甚至直接写在代码里。我个人比较推荐用JSON格式存储,方便读取和修改。例如:

{  "wx_session": "your_wx_session_value",  "wx_token": "your_wx_token_value",  "other_cookie": "other_cookie_value"}
登录后复制

使用Cookie: 现在,到了最激动人心的时刻。当你需要访问微信小店的接口时,就把这些Cookie带上。具体怎么带?这取决于你使用的编程语言和HTTP库。比如,在Python里,你可以用requests库:

import requestsimport json# 从JSON文件读取Cookiewith open('cookies.json', 'r') as f:    cookies = json.load(f)# 构建请求头headers = {    'Cookie': '; '.join([f'{k}={v}' for k, v in cookies.items()])}# 发送请求response = requests.get('https://your_weixin_shop_api', headers=headers)print(response.text)
登录后复制

这段代码的核心在于构建headers,把存储的Cookie拼接成字符串,然后放到请求头里。

定期更新Cookie: 微信小店的Cookie是有有效期的,过一段时间就会失效。所以,你需要定期更新Cookie。一个比较好的做法是,写一个定时任务,每天自动登录一次微信小店,抓取新的Cookie,并更新到存储里。

微信小店Cookie失效的原因有哪些?

Cookie失效的原因有很多,最常见的就是过期时间到了。微信小店为了安全考虑,会设置一个Cookie的有效期,一旦超过这个时间,Cookie就自动失效了。另外,如果你的IP地址发生变化,或者你的微信账号在其他设备上登录,也可能导致Cookie失效。甚至,微信小店的服务器进行升级或者维护,也可能导致Cookie失效。总之,Cookie的寿命是很脆弱的,需要我们时刻关注。

如何避免Cookie被微信小店识别为非法?

避免Cookie被识别为非法,关键在于模拟真实用户的行为。不要一下子发送大量的请求,要控制请求的频率。另外,尽量使用真实的User-Agent,不要使用爬虫的User-Agent。还有,可以模拟用户的鼠标移动和键盘输入,让微信小店觉得你是一个真实的用户,而不是一个机器人。此外,可以尝试使用代理IP,避免因为IP地址被封禁而导致Cookie失效。

长期免登录方案的潜在风险与应对策略

长期免登录虽然方便,但也存在一定的风险。比如,如果你的Cookie泄露了,别人就可以冒用你的身份登录微信小店,进行一些恶意操作。为了应对这种风险,你可以采取以下措施:

加密存储Cookie: 不要把Cookie明文存储,要进行加密处理。可以使用一些成熟的加密算法,比如AES、DES等。限制Cookie的使用范围: 尽量只在必要的时候才使用Cookie,不要把Cookie暴露给不信任的第三方。定期检查Cookie的安全性: 定期检查Cookie是否被泄露,如果发现异常,及时更换Cookie。设置IP白名单: 限制只有特定的IP地址才能使用Cookie,防止别人冒用你的身份。

记住,安全永远是第一位的。在追求便利的同时,一定要做好安全防护,避免造成不必要的损失。

热门推荐

更多

热门文章

更多

首页  返回顶部

本站所有软件都由网友上传,如有侵犯您的版权,请发邮件youleyoucom@outlook.com